Q359. If the landfill accepts only incinerator ash (inert) and does not generate gas, should we consider reporting the quantities of ash?


A359. See the definition of an MSW landfill in the rule. If the landfill has only accepted incinerator ash, it would not meet the definition of an MSW landfill as this waste would not generally be considered ‘household waste.’ Furthermore, if a landfill receives only inert wastes, even if the wastes are considered household wastes, the MSW landfill facility would not be expected to exceed the reporting threshold in the rule. If an MSW landfill (required to report under subpart HH) receives a segregated inert waste stream (such as incinerator ash), this waste quantity is considered to be included in Equation HH-1 and the quantity of inert waste would need to be reported as required in §98.346(a).
